Subject: Key rotation — cold storage archival

Team,

Heads-up for the sync: the Glacierbin archival job finished moving all cold storage buckets older than 18 months into the Permafrost tier last night. As part of the cutover, we rotated the credentials the archiver uses to talk to the Vaultmere index service. Old keys die Friday 17:00. Update any local tooling before then; the cron jobs are already patched. The new Vaultmere key for the archiver follows.

gateway credential: vxb23-HxQ21C0wnch2XjJUYrBndSF

Subject: Loading dock hours — please read before your first delivery

Hello and welcome to Quillbrook House. The loading dock on Tanner Lane accepts deliveries between 08:00 and 14:00, Monday to Friday only. Please book a slot with the front desk at least a day ahead, and make sure couriers have your name and floor number. Out-of-hours deliveries are refused without exception, so plan accordingly. When collecting your parcels, open the dock-side door with the code shown below.

badge for fafop-fajof: bdg-Z-47

Subject: Handover — Fleet Fuel Report

Harriet,

Handing over the Cartwheel fleet fuel-usage report ahead of your review. The nightly job aggregates pump transactions into `fuel_monthly`, runs at 02:10, and emails the ops distribution list. Access is read-only via the `reporting` role; no write grants anywhere in the pipeline. Last schema change was the addition of the `region_code` column in March. Logs sit on the reporting host under `/var/log/fuelrep`. The report job authenticates to the warehouse with the connection string below.

— Dmitri

database URL for tajog-bajeg: mysql://soreth_svc:OzsCjhu@db-6997.nelvrostack.internal:5432/kelax

Q: My plugin's notifications get throttled during big fan-out events — what gives? A: The Hummingpost dispatcher applies backpressure when downstream queues for the Cloverhatch relay exceed their watermark. Your sends aren't dropped, just delayed; they replay in order once pressure eases. Don't retry aggressively — that makes it worse. Respect the 429-style hints in the response headers. If your plugin keeps hitting the ceiling, write to the platform integrations desk.

escalation mailbox, yajeg-bageg: quenax.olidor@lumiccorp.internal